The Project
THE GREENHEART PROJECT is a simple idea, centered around a sailing cargo ship. Not the traditional, square-rigged tall ship of the nineteenth century, but a completely modern, efficient, cooperative trading vessel, powered by the sun and the wind alone. This specially designed ship will serve many functions. It will be a transport vessel, the international headquarters for the enterprise, and a training vessel for young people from around the world. The unique ship will also serve as a promotional platform, to publicize international cooperation, clean energy, fair trade and sustainable industry. This ship, named the Sailing Vessel Greenheart will circle the globe on a zigzag route between ports in the affluent North and needy developing nations, alternating between charitable (aid & relief delivery) and merchant (fair trade commerce) legs.
Before leaving port in Europe, North America or Japan, the crew of the S/V Greenheart will coordinate with local and international charities, NGO's, relief organizations and ministries of the relevant governments in order to load aid supplies, medical and educational donations, and development project support. These cargoes will be delivered free of charge to countries in the developing world. By using trade winds and traditional sailing routes in addition to electric motors powered by the sun, S/V Greenheart will be able to deliver her cargo without burning petroleum products for propulsion.
As the charitable supplies are delivered, Greenheart will buy environmentally sound and sustainability sourced products from small producers and cooperatives at better-than-market prices to support their efforts. Because of her extremely shallow draught, S/V Greenheart will be able to load at small ports and up rivers presently unable to accommodate ocean-going vessels, thus providing new access to international markets for small producers. Greenheart will not only sail with merchandise, but also with the contact names and addreses of the producers in order to serve as a trade promotion platform once in port in the developed world.
After stowing the bulk product and setting sail for northern ports, the crew of S/V Greenheart will use solar-electric power to re-package and label her cargo in the ship's processing shop. Thus, Greenheart eliminates middlemen by preparing bulk purchases for retail sales. By means of the ship's solar powered satellite uplink, the crew will contact sympathetic environmental, renewable energy and international fair trade organizations (including the very ones that were provided free delivery service ) at the ship's destination to prepare the venue for her arrival event. Because of the unique characteristics of size, shallow draught and folding masts, S/V Greenheart will be able to travel under bridges and up rivers, to berth at the most publicly accessible waterfront of the city, where no other ocean going ships can go.
The arrival event will be a public showing of a unique sailing ship to promote clean, sustainable industry, a marketing platform for small producers from needy nations, and a sales event. The repackaged goods will be sold to the public at these events to provide the capital for the charitable legs of S/V Greenheart's round-the-world voyages.
Greenheart is an entirely new concept that combines the modern technologies of solar power and satellite communications with the ancient science of sail to produce a cargo ship with no fuel costs and unlimited range that can serve as its own international office. The unique design of this ship enables her to connect the most remote coasts and rivers of the world with the centers of the world's most prosperous cities. One third of Greenheart's staff/crew will be paid trainees from developing nations, learning the technical and administrative skills useful for launching similar sustainable enterprises in their home waters. By combining both charitable and profitable aspects while embracing the principles of environmental protection, sustainability and fair trade, Greenheart will offer a very public model of a self-funding, respectable institution. We hope to inspire people and organizations around the world to re-think the boundries of business and of international aid. In time, we intend to build a fleet of non-polluting sailing cargo ships for use in poverty abatement programs around the world.
Our Mission
We at Greenheart are striving to create a new model of a clean, cooperative and sustainable enterprise. We commit to supporting equally the environmental, the social, and the economic viability of our world by adhering to the principles of fairness and accountability in trade, respect and stewardship for the environment, and a charitable, global disposition. By operating a solar-power assisted sailing trading ship around a global route with complementary loads of development aid and fair trade goods, we intend to function as a self-funding charitable merchantman. Our goal is to forge connections, both physical and institutional, among societies, environments and economies the world around. We propose using our unique platform to bring together organizations, institutions, governments and corporations with sincere desires to further sustainability for our planet. Both our ship and her crew are dedicated to promoting, by example, the practice of environmental protection, fair & equitable trade relations, and the responsible use of renewable resources.
